1) Um algoritmo A2 que necessite de f2Não = 50 unidades de memória (independente do valor de n) é um algoritmo com complexidade de espaço ____________ em função do tamanho da entrada.
Assinale a alternativa que preenche corretamente a lacuna.
Escolha uma:
a.
Polinomial
b.
Constante
c.
Linear Incorreto
d.
Recursiva
e.
Temporal
2) Considere o algoritmo de ordenação por inserção:
(imagem 1)
Independente de a entrada ser de melhor caso, caso médio ou pior caso, o espaço utilizado para memória auxiliar é:
- 1 inteiro, para armazenar a variável i;
- 1 inteiro, para armazenar a variável j;
- 1 inteiro, para armazenar a variável k;
- e 1 inteiro, para armazenar a variável t.
Sendo assim, qual a função que descreve a quantidade de memória auxiliar do algoritmo de ordenação por inserção?
Assinale a alternativa correta.
Escolha uma:
a.
fNão = 4.
b.
fNão = n + 4.
c.
fNão = 4n. Incorreto
d.
fNão = n4.
e.
fNão = log(4).
3) Sobre o cálculo da complexidade de espaço, analise as afirmativas:
I. Na memória auxiliar não são considerados os espaços necessários para: o próprio programa; a entrada; e a saída.
II. O armazenamento do próprio programa é desconsiderado pois é independente do tamanho da entrada.
III. Os armazenamentos da entrada e da saída não são considerados pois, na comparação de diferentes algoritmos que resolvem o mesmo problema, todos ocupam a mesma quantidade de memória para armazenamento da entrada e da saída.
Neste contexto, é correto o que se afirma em:
Escolha uma:
a.
II e III, apenas. Incorreto
b.
II, apenas.
c.
III, apenas.
d.
I, II e III.
e.
I e II, apenas.
Anexos:
Soluções para a tarefa
Respondido por
1
Resposta:
1 - Constante
2 - f(n) = 4
3 - I, II e III
Explicação:
Corrigido pelo AVA
Perguntas interessantes
Matemática,
4 meses atrás
Português,
4 meses atrás
Matemática,
4 meses atrás
Português,
4 meses atrás
Biologia,
4 meses atrás
Matemática,
9 meses atrás
Ed. Física,
9 meses atrás
Português,
9 meses atrás